CEN, the European Committee for Standardization, announces the documentation on 'the European e-Competence Framework' is available now for public comments (deadline for comments - 7 September 2008).

CEN/ISSS is the name given to CEN's ICT (Information and Communication Technologies) sector activities. It "provides market players with a comprehensive and integrated range of standardization services and products, in order to contribute to the success of the Information Society in Europe".

CEN/ISSS works through CEN Focus Groups, Technical Committees and Workshops and has now started a workhop on ICT skills.

The documentation on 'the European e-Competence Framework' is available now for public comments (deadline for comments - 7 September 2008). On their website, they offer the next documents for review:
- Draft CWA on European e-Competence Framework
- User guidelines for the application of the European e-Competence Framework
